Paytm Checkout Создание заказа - PullRequest
0 голосов
/ 29 марта 2020

Я использовал следующий код для создания контрольной суммы,

checkSumMap.put("MID" , "XXXXXXXXXXXXXXXXXXXX");
checkSumMap.put("ORDER_ID" , "TEST-XXXX");
checkSumMap.put("CUST_ID" , "123455");
checkSumMap.put("INDUSTRY_TYPE_ID" , "Retail");
checkSumMap.put("CHANNEL_ID" , "WAP");
checkSumMap.put("TXN_AMOUNT" , "1.00");
checkSumMap.put("WEBSITE" , "test.co.in");
checkSumMap.put("EMAIL" , "test@gmail.com");
checkSumMap.put("MOBILE_NO" , "9999999999");
checkSumMap.put("CALLBACK_URL" , "MY_CALLBACK_URL");

String checksum = CheckSumServiceHelper.getCheckSumServiceHelper().genrateCheckSum("MY_MKEY", checkSumMap);

Контрольная сумма генерируется, я могу напечатать контрольную сумму.

Но я не уверен, как ордер генерируется на сервере Paytm после генерации контрольной суммы. Я новичок в интеграции платежей и мне трудно понять весь процесс.

...